【优技教育】Oracle 19c OCP 082题库(第16题)- 2024年修正版
因此,如您所见,不再需要PL/SQL函数来发出游标并返回值,您可以将其直接嵌入到SELECT语句中。那么,这会带来什么好处呢?嗯,有很多,从简化游标到减少上下文切换。返回0行,则评估为null:SQL>select2(selectenamefromempwhereempno=7788)3fromemp;(SELECTENAMEFROMEMPWOracle19cOCP认证...
数据库半年度盘点:20+国内外数据库重大更新及技术精要
1、FLUSHHOSTS语句在MySQL8.0.23中已弃用,已被删除。要清除主机缓存,请truncatePerformanceSchema的host_cache表或改用mysqladminflush-hosts。2、组复制:group_replication_set_as_primary()现在等待DDL和DCL语句完成,然后再选择新的主节点。3、删除--innodb和--skip-innodb服务器选项。从MySQL5.6版本起,...
扣丁学堂浅谈Oracle SQL语句之常见优化方法总结
例子1:Select*fromur_user_infowherephone_nolike‘%10%’;例子2:Select*fromur_user_infowherephone_nolike‘10%’;由于例1中通配符(%)在搜寻词首出现,所以oracle系统不使用phone_no的索引,通配符会降低查询的效率,但当通配符不再首出现,又能使用索引,如例2所示。二.ORACLE语句优化规则...
30个Oracle语句优化规则详解(1)
例如:第一组的两个SQL语句是相同的(可以共享),而第二组中的两个语句是不同的(即使在运行时,赋于不同的绑定变量相同的值)a.selectpin,namefrompeoplewherepin=:blk1.pin;selectpin,namefrompeoplewherepin=:blk1.pin;b.selectpin,namefrompeoplewherepin=:blk1.ot_i...
Python操作Oracle数据库:cx_Oracle
另外,所有cx_Oracle执行的语句都含有分号“;”或斜杠“/”:connection=cx_Oracle.connect("username","password","192.168.1.2/helowin",encoding="UTF-8")cur=connection.cursor()cur.execute("select*fromSCOTT.STUDENTS;")#含有分号,抛出异常...
通往测试架构师的必经路:Oracle常见性能问题调优总结
select*fromuserwhereuserid=:b1;硬解析指标参考AWR报告中LoadProfile-->HardParse/Sec(参考值:<2or10),笔者一般会在大于1时用以下脚本查找可能需使用绑定变量优化的SQL(www.e993.com)2024年11月10日。1、利用force_matching_signature查询可能可以使用绑定变量的语句数量...
Oracle SQL 性能优化技巧
ORACLE采用自下而上的顺序解析WHERE子句,根据这个原理,表之间的连接必须写在其他WHERE条件之前,那些可以过滤掉最大数量记录的条件必须写在WHERE子句的末尾。6.SELECT子句中避免使用'*'当你想在SELECT子句中列出所有的COLUMN时,使用动态SQL列引用'*'是一个方便的方法。不幸的是,这是一个非常低效的方法。
新手必读:Oracle入门教程
select*fromtablenamewhere…andrownum<5orderbyname选出结果后用name排序显示结果。(先选再排序)注意:只能用以上符号(<、<=、!=)。select*fromtablenamewhererownum!=10;返回的是前9条记录。不能用:>,>=,=,Between...and。由于rownum是一个总是从1开始的伪列,Oracle认为这...
入侵Oracle数据库时常用的操作命令
connectinternal/oracleASSYSDBA;(scott/tiger)connsys/change_on_installassysdba;4、SQL>startup;启动数据库实例5、查看当前的所有数据库:select*fromv$database;selectnamefromv$database;descv$databases;查看数据库结构字段...
mysql到oracle数据库迁移中常见问题及解决方法 作者/常雨骁
6、扩字段可以用oracle的select语句拼接出alter语句,一个例子如下SELECT'ALTERTABLE'||OWNER||'.'||TABLE_NAME||'MODIFY('||COLUMN_NAME||''||DATA_TYPE||'('||CEIL(DATA_LENGTH*3)||'));'FROMDBA_TAB_COLUMNS...